The first question to consider when ordering resistors for Sri Lanka is the required resistance value. This value is specified in ohms and determines how much resistance the component will provide in the circuit. It is important to choose a resistor with the correct resistance value to ensure that the circuit functions properly.
The second question to ask is about the power rating of the resistor. The power rating indicates how much power the resistor can handle before it becomes damaged. Choosing a resistor with the appropriate power rating is essential to prevent overheating and ensure the reliability of the circuit.
Next, the tolerance level of the resistor should be considered. This value specifies the maximum deviation from the specified resistance value. Choosing a resistor with a tight tolerance level is important for applications where precision is crucial.
The type of resistor is also an important consideration. There are various types of resistors, including carbon film, metal film, and wire wound resistors, each with its own advantages and disadvantages. Selecting the right type of resistor will depend on factors such as cost, size, and stability.
Finally, any special considerations should be taken into account when ordering resistors for Sri Lanka. This may include factors such as the size of the resistor, the temperature coefficient, or any other specific requirements for the application.
